The Veltassa Challenge: Mechanism Unlocked
Summary of work
Hyperkalemia is a serious condition often linked to chronic kidney disease, heart failure, and diabetes. Veltassa, a next-generation potassium binder with a unique calcium-based ion exchange mechanism, offers a clinically valuable alternative to sodium-based treatments. Yet despite its efficacy, Veltassa struggled to stand out in a market dominated by a louder, better-funded competitor.To unlock growth, we conducted in-depth qualitative and quantitative research with nephrologists, revealing a critical insight: while Veltassa was recognised, its scientific differentiation wasn’t understood. The calcium-based mechanism, key to avoiding sodium-related risks, was seen as theoretical rather than urgent.This insight drove a strategic pivot. We avoided direct comparisons and instead created a bold, educational experience at ERA 2025, designed to reframe Veltassa’s value. Through a phased approach, including insight gathering, strategic reframing, creative development, and an interactive booth experience, we successfully repositioned Veltassa.The success was evident: booth footfall rose more than a quarter, 4 out of 5 nephrologists at ERA recalled that Veltassa is a calcium-ion exchange binder, and qualitative feedback confirmed that HCPs were actively re-evaluating Veltassa’s role in patient care. The campaign didn’t just drive engagement, it changed minds, proving that when science is made memorable, it becomes meaningful.
